Description :
This administrator coordinates special programs in the Curriculum, Special Education, and Personnel offices to support our District operations and goals.
Position Details :
  • Bargaining Unit: Orchard Park Central Office Administrators
  • Salary: Negotiable
  • Work Year: Twelve (12) Months
Responsibilities :
  • Manage financial aspects of the Curriculum and Special Education offices including:
    • Medicaid reimbursement.
    • Federal Grants.
  • Oversee student enrollment process including:
    • Residency verification.
    • Proof of immunization.
  • Work collaboratively with the Assistant Superintendent for Personnel & Pupil Services to:
    • Facilitate the development of specific action and implementation plans for special education subgroup student populations focused on student growth and achievement.
    • Oversee the 504 and medical plans of students to ensure consistency district-wide in accordance with education laws and regulations.
    • Administer the home instruction of students.
    • Supervise the school nurses, adherence to school health regulations (i.e. required school screenings, immunization requirements, etc.).
  • Work collaboratively with the Assistant Superintendent of Curriculum & Pupil Services to:
    • Facilitate the development of specific action and implementation plans for subgroup student populations centered on student achievement.
    • Organize, plan, and communicate professional development opportunities for District staff.
    • Seek additional sources for funding (i.e. grants), and maximize financial efficiencies through collaboration with other districts and/or BOCES.
    • Co-facilitate Superintendent's Conference Days with the Assistant Superintendent of Curriculum & Pupil Services and manage the logistical details for district-wide training and conference days (i.e. securing speakers, communicating plans with staff, preparing feedback surveys, etc.).
    • Facilitate the New Teacher Academy Program, and support the New Teacher Orientation Program.
  • Work collaboratively with the Assistant Superintendent for Curriculum & Instruction, the Assistant Superintendent for Personnel & Pupil Services, and the Special Education Director to support the Response to Intervention model through:
    • The promotion of effective, evidenced based tiered interventions
    • The universal screening process
    • The application of data to make decisions on interventions and student support services.
  • Assist with the oversight of the UPK program
  • Conduct teacher observations, as assigned, to assist central office and building level administrators in accordance with APPR regulations and locally negotiated plans.
  • Actively participate in our District Leadership Council (DLC) and Professional Development Council (PDC) and/or Special Education Leadership Council as requested.
  • Perform other duties and responsibilities as assigned by the supervisor.
Qualifications :
  • Valid NYS School District Administrator (SDA or SDL).
  • Minimum education level of a Master's Degree.
  • Minimum of 5 years successful teaching experience.
  • Knowledge of 504 Accommodations, Special Education regulations and the Committee for Special Education process preferred.
  • Knowledge of McKinney-Vento Homeless Student Act, enrollment and school registration regulations and procedures preferred.
  • Knowledge of the District's CDEP and major goals and initiatives including those related to: ELA & Mathematics, Response to Intervention, assessments, and the NYS and Common Core Learning Standards.
  • Previous administrative leadership experience preferred.
  • Previous grant writing and/or budget oversight experience preferred.
Personal Qualities :
  • Outstanding interpersonal skills and an ability to collaborate with teachers and administrators.
  • Strong self-starter and the ability to see the "big picture"
  • Strong organizational skills.
  • Strong time-management skills and ability to meet deadlines.
  • Demonstrated ability to communicate in a professional manner both orally and in writing.
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ality.
Reports to :
  • Assistant Superintendent of Curriculum & Pupil Services and
  • Assistant Superintendent for Personnel & Pupil Services
